Microsurgery
| Medical Definition: |
The performance of surgical procedures with the aid of a microscope. |

Mohs Surgery - A surgical technique used primarily in the treatment of skin neoplasms, especially basal cell or squamous cell carcinoma of the skin. This procedure is a microscopically controlled excision of cutaneous tumors either after fixation in vivo or after freezing the tissue. Serial examinations of fresh tissue specimens are most frequently done. |
